This paper describes cooling performance of miniature cooling fans and blowers. In recent years, several types of miniature devices that can generate cooling airflow into electronic equipment have been developed. These devices are enough thin and small and these are usable in high-density packaging electronic equipment such as laptop computers and portable devices. In this study, we are trying to evaluate an optimum selection of these devices in order to obtain higher cooling performance in high-density packaging electronic equipment by using these devices. In this report, we compared effectiveness of three types of the miniature fans and the piezoelectric micro blower mounted in the narrow flow passage from the viewpoint of cooling performance through heat transfer experiment.
